    If you are switching back to BlackBerry from an iphone purely because the app gap seems to be closer I'd say better use your money elsewhere. I've been on 10.2.1 leaked 176 for a while now and I'm having a blast. That's mainly due to the fact that I've been using BlackBerry OS since 10.1. By actually switching back to BlackBerry will diminish your app experience because all the apps you have on your iphone function much better still.
    That being said, if there are other reasons you've been wanting to switch back but hesitant because the app gap. Then do it.
    My experience with the new runtime is that first of all I'm able to finally use apps that's I've always wanted. They work, but not 100% smooth. The start time for the app takes pretty long, as long as up to 5-7 seconds. There are also slight lag times when in using these apps, not as responsive but nonetheless , they work.
